A palatable green leaf tea from Camellia sinensis var. assamica is disclosed. Infusion of 2 g of the leaf tea in 200 ml water for 1.5 minutes at 90°C produces a beverage comprising catechins in an amount of between 0.01 and 0.1% by weight of the beverage. Also disclosed is a process for manufacturing the leaf tea product wherein fresh leaf from var. assamica is macerated using a combination of a rotorvane and double-cone processor.
